He stole my valedictorian seat. I stole his peace of mind. Fair trade. Perth has been #1 since freshman year. GPA: 3.97. Streak: 4 years. Ego: massive. Until Santa beats him by 0.01 and takes the valedictorian seat. Now the dean's "genius idea" has shackled them together for a year-long thesis project. Late nights. Shared lab. One pedestrian bridge. Zero personal space. Scoreboard so far: Perth 14 - Santa 14. Until today. Now it's 15-14. Santa. They fight. They compete. They sabotage each other's coffee. Perth thinks Santa's just a cocky golden boy who wins at everything. Santa thinks Perth's a cold perfectionist who only cares about grades. But then Santa's ex comes back to Thailand. And suddenly "I hate you" starts sounding a lot like "Don't leave me again." Perth keeps misunderstanding every text, every late-night call, every look Santa won't explain. And Santa keeps pretending he's fine while his past tears him apart. Who wins in the end?
